Output 8f8fb433c48f31d76379c9aef9481604cd7bc6800a0b2fab361a9f311158de43:41

value
1627940
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86141fdcd54ebcc59fb54951cfe701315e9229e9 OP_EQUAL
address
3DuxaXBmntH9e8wrGttrsgRU7u6L6cyBvZ
transaction
8f8fb433c48f31d76379c9aef9481604cd7bc6800a0b2fab361a9f311158de43
spent
true